Maison >Java >javaDidacticiel >Comment puis-je contrôler le formatage du code Eclipse pour des sections de code spécifiques ?

Comment puis-je contrôler le formatage du code Eclipse pour des sections de code spécifiques ?

Mary-Kate Olsen
Mary-Kate Olsenoriginal
2024-12-13 02:03:10577parcourir

How Can I Control Eclipse's Code Formatting for Specific Code Sections?

Contrôle du formatage du code dans Eclipse pour des sections de code spécifiques

Le formateur de code d'Eclipse offre un moyen pratique de maintenir la cohérence du code, mais il n'est pas toujours possible alignez-vous sur vos préférences de formatage pour certaines structures de code. Pour éviter les modifications de formatage indésirables, vous pouvez demander à Eclipse d'ignorer des lignes de code spécifiques.

Eclipse 3.6 et versions ultérieures

Dans Eclipse 3.6 et versions ultérieures, vous pouvez utiliser des commentaires pour contrôler le formatage. Pour désactiver le formatage d'un bloc de code, insérez le commentaire suivant à son début :

// @formatter:off

Et pour réactiver le formatage, utilisez ce commentaire :

// @formatter:on

Pour activer cette fonctionnalité, accédez à Java > Style de code > Formateur > Modifier > Balises désactivées/activées. Cochez la case Activer les balises désactivées/activées et spécifiez les mots-clés de balise souhaités (par exemple, START-ECLIPSE-FORMATTING et STOP-ECLIPSE-FORMATTING).

Remarque : Assurez-vous que ces commentaires ne sont pas placés dans les commentaires Javadoc, car cela pourrait entraîner la génération de Javadoc. erreurs.

Considérations supplémentaires

  • Reconfiguration pour les utilisateurs d'Eclipse : Les utilisateurs d'Eclipse qui rencontrent des problèmes de formatage devront peut-être ajuster leur Paramètres Préférences dans Eclipse pour activer les balises Off/On fonctionnalité.
  • Approches alternatives : Si l'approche basée sur les commentaires ne convient pas, envisagez d'utiliser un autre formateur externe comme Jalopy ou JIndent qui peut respecter vos règles de formatage personnalisées.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n